溫馨提示×

python linux指令的使用場景

小樊
104
2024-12-10 17:10:12
欄目: 編程語言

Python在Linux環境中的應用場景非常廣泛,從基礎的系統管理到復雜的數據處理,Python都能提供強大的支持。以下是Python在Linux中執行指令的使用場景示例:

場景一:系統管理和監控

Python可以通過ossubprocess模塊執行系統命令,進行系統管理和監控。例如,使用os.system('df -h')可以查看磁盤使用情況,使用subprocess.run(['ps', '-ef'], capture_output=True)可以查看當前系統進程。

場景二:自動化部署

在自動化部署場景中,Python可以通過fabric庫連接和管理遠程服務器,執行部署命令。例如,使用fabric庫可以簡化遠程服務器的部署流程,提高效率。

場景三:數據處理和分析

Python在數據處理和分析方面有著廣泛應用。通過pandas等庫,可以處理和分析大量數據。例如,使用pandas讀取CSV文件并進行數據清洗和分析。

場景四:網絡操作

Python還可以用于網絡操作,如發送郵件、獲取網頁內容等。例如,使用smtplib發送郵件,使用requests庫獲取網頁內容。

場景五:Web開發和API服務

Python在Web開發和API服務方面也有廣泛應用。通過FlaskDjango等框架,可以開發Web應用,提供API服務。例如,使用Flask框架開發一個簡單的Web應用,提供用戶數據查詢功能。

通過上述示例,可以看到Python在Linux環境中的應用場景非常多樣化,能夠滿足各種系統管理和開發需求。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女